body.vine-and-Swine{font-size:16px;font-family: 'BebasNeueBold'; }
.header-section .navbar-inverse .navbar-nav>li a{font-family: 'corbel';}
.vine-and-Swine h2{font-size:40px; color:#d9d9d9; font-family: 'BebasNeueBold'; letter-spacing:5px; text-align:uppercase;}
.vine-and-Swine h2, .vine-and-Swine h4, .vine-and-Swine p{margin:0;} 
.vine-and-Swine ul.colors{margin:0; padding:0;}
/* .vine-and-Swine ul li{padding:0; list-style:none;} */
.vine-and-Swine ul.colors li{padding:0; list-style:none;}
.vine-and-Swine .pdl{padding-left:0;}
/* banner css start */
.vine-and-Swine section.banner-bovin{width:100%; background-image: url(../portfolio/Bovine-and-swine/images/bg/bg1.png); text-align:center; padding:80px 0 88px 0; float:left; background-size:cover;}
.vine-and-Swine section.banner-bovin .banner_top, .banner_bottom{width:100%; float:left; text-align:center;}
.vine-and-Swine section.banner-bovin .banner_top img, .banner_bottom img{ display:inline-block;}
.vine-and-Swine .banner_bottom{padding-top:83px;}
/* banner css end */

/* section project start */
.vine-and-Swine section.project{float:left; width:100%; padding:60px 0 84px 0; background-size:cover; background-image:url(../portfolio/Bovine-and-swine/images/bg/bg2.png);}
.vine-and-Swine .project_top, .project_bottom{float:left; width:100%;}
.vine-and-Swine .project_top{padding-bottom:97px; border-bottom:1px solid #949393;}
.vine-and-Swine .project_top h4{color:#949393; font-size:20px; letter-spacing:3px; margin-top:23px;}
.vine-and-Swine .project_bottom{padding-top:128px;}
.vine-and-Swine .sec-top{margin-top:107px;position:relative;}
.vine-and-Swine .sec-top:before{content:""; position:absolute; left:0; right:28%; border-bottom:1px solid #949393; bottom:-44px;}
.vine-and-Swine .sec-top:after{content:""; position:absolute; left:42%; right:0; border-left:1px solid #949393; bottom:-243%; top:-17%; }
.vine-and-Swine .sec-top, .sec-bottom{float:left; width:100%;}
.vine-and-Swine .sec-bottom{padding-top:82px;}
.vine-and-Swine .text_image{float:left; width:100%;}
.vine-and-Swine .text_image img{max-width:100%;}
.vine-and-Swine .left-text{margin-left:40px;}
/* section project end */

/* section color palatte start */
.vine-and-Swine section.color-palette{float:left;  width:100%; padding:75px 0 0px 0; background-size:cover; background-image:url(../portfolio/Bovine-and-swine/images/bg/bg3.png); text-align:center;}
.vine-and-Swine section.color-palette h2{text-align:left;}
.vine-and-Swine ul.colors{margin-top:225px; float:left; width:100%;}
.vine-and-Swine li.color{height:93px; width:93px; border-radius:50%; background-color:#e73831; display:inline-block; margin-left:150px;position:relative;}
.vine-and-Swine li.color:first-child{margin	:0;}
.vine-and-Swine li.color:before{content:""; border:1px solid #949393;position:absolute;top:-25px; bottom:-25px; left:-25px; right:-25px; border-radius:50%;}
.vine-and-Swine li.color:after{content: ""; border: 1px solid #949393; position: absolute; left: 142px; right: -13px; top: 50%;width: 50px;}
.vine-and-Swine li.color:last-child:after{display:none;}
.vine-and-Swine span.name{line-height:93px; vertical-align:middle; float:right; font-size:20px; color:#fff; letter-spacing:3px; margin-right:-25px;}
.vine-and-Swine li.two{background-color:#363636;}
.vine-and-Swine li.three{background-color:#c2c2c2;}
.vine-and-Swine li.four{background-color:#ffffff;}
.vine-and-Swine li.four span.name{color:#c2c2c2;}
.vine-and-Swine .sectio_top, .vine-and-Swine .sectio_bottom{float:left; width:100%;}
.vine-and-Swine section.color-palette .sectio_bottom{padding-top:190px;}
.vine-and-Swine .image_sectgion{width:95%; display:inline-block; margin-top:108px;}
.vine-and-Swine .image_sectgion img{float:left; width:100%;}
/* section color palatte end */

/* section four start */
.vine-and-Swine section.sec_four{float:left; width:100%; padding-top:106px; background-color:#111	;}
.vine-and-Swine .lptp_sec{width:95%; position:relative;}
.vine-and-Swine .lptp_sec:before{content:""; position:absolute; width:43px; border-top:1px solid #949393; top:50%;  right:-55px;}
.vine-and-Swine .lptp_sec, .vine-and-Swine .tab-sec{float:left; }
.vine-and-Swine .lptp_sec img, .vine-and-Swine .tab-sec img{float:left; width:100%;}
/* section four end */

/*.bs-footer start */
.vine-and-Swine section.bs-footer{padding:115px 0 106px 0; float:left; background-size:cover; background-image:url(../portfolio/Bovine-and-swine/images/bg/footer-bg_02.png); width:100%; background-repeat:no-repeat; background-position:bottom;}
.vine-and-Swine .tab_section{float:left; width:100%;}
.vine-and-Swine section.bs-footer h2{ width:100%; text-align:center; float:left; padding-top:105px; font-size:60px; letter-spacing:12px; color:#ffffff;}
/* footer end */

/* media quarys */



@media (min-width:992px){
.vine-and-Swine .sec-top, .vine-and-Swine .sec-bottom{margin-left:15px;}
}
@media (max-width:1224px){
.vine-and-Swine section.banner-bovin{padding-left:15px; padding-right:15px;}
}

@media (max-width:991px){
.vine-and-Swine section.banner-bovin{padding-left:15px; padding-right:15px;}
.vine-and-Swine section.project{padding-top:0; padding-bottom:55px;}
.vine-and-Swine .project_top{padding-bottom:60px;}
.vine-and-Swine .project_bottom{padding-top:100px;}
.vine-and-Swine .left-text{margin-left:0;}
.vine-and-Swine .sec-top{margin-top:80px;}
.vine-and-Swine .pdl{padding-left:15px;}
.vine-and-Swine .sec-top:before{top:-15%; bottom:0; border-top: 1px solid #949393; border-bottom:0; left:2%; right:2%;}
.vine-and-Swine .sec-top:after{top:0; bottom:-130%; border-bottom: 1px solid #949393; border-left:0; left:2%; right:2%; z-index:0;}
.vine-and-Swine .sec-bottom{padding:0;}
.vine-and-Swine .text_image{padding-top:30px;}
.vine-and-Swine li.color{margin-left:100px;}
.vine-and-Swine .tab-sec{float:left; width:100%; text-align:center; margin-top:80px;}
.vine-and-Swine .tab-sec img{float:none; width:auto;}
.vine-and-Swine .lptp_sec:before{bottom:-40px; top:inherit; left:50%;} 
.vine-and-Swine .sec_four .pdl{padding:0;}
.vine-and-Swine li.color:after{top: 0;
    width: 0;
    bottom: 0;}
.vine-and-Swine section.color-palette{padding-top:100px;}
.vine-and-Swine ul.colors{margin-top:80px;}
.vine-and-Swine section.color-palette .sectio_bottom{padding-top:120px;}
.vine-and-Swine .image_sectgion{margin-top:80px;}
.vine-and-Swine section.sec_four{padding-top:100px;}
.vine-and-Swine section.bs-footer h2{padding-top:80px;}
.vine-and-Swine section.bs-footer{padding:100px 0;}
}

@media (max-width:767px){
	
.vine-and-Swine .banner_top img{float:none; width:360px;}

.vine-and-Swine .project_top{text-align:center;}
.vine-and-Swine h2{text-align:center !important;}
.vine-and-Swine ul.colors{width:150px; margin:80px auto; float:none;}	
.vine-and-Swine li.color{margin-left:0 !important; margin-bottom:100px !important;}
.vine-and-Swine li.color:after{bottom:-58%; left:0%; right:0%; top:inherit; width:inherit;}
.vine-and-Swine .lptp_sec:before{left:48%;}
.vine-and-Swine section.color-palette .sectio_bottom{padding-top:0 !important;}
.vine-and-Swine section.bs-footer h2{font-size:40px;}
}

@media (max-width:480px){
.vine-and-Swine section.banner-bovin{padding:60px 15px;}
.vine-and-Swine .banner_bottom{padding-top:50px;}
.vine-and-Swine .banner_top img{ width:230px !important;}
.vine-and-Swine section.project{padding:60px 0;}
.vine-and-Swine .project_top{padding-bottom:30px;}
.vine-and-Swine .project_top h4{margin-top:40px;}
.vine-and-Swine .sec-top{margin-top:30px;}
.vine-and-Swine .sec-top:before{top:0;}
.vine-and-Swine .sec-top:after{bottom:-120%;}
.vine-and-Swine .project_bottom{padding-top:60px;}
.vine-and-Swine .tab-sec img{width:100% ; float:left ;}
.vine-and-Swine section.color-palette{padding:60px 0;}
.vine-and-Swine ul.colors{margin:70px auto;}
.vine-and-Swine li.color:last-child{margin-bottom:0!important;}
.vine-and-Swine image_sectgion{margin-top:60px;}

.vine-and-Swine section.sec_four{padding:60px 0;}
.vine-and-Swine section.bs-footer{padding:60px 0;}
.vine-and-Swine section.bs-footer h2{padding-top:60px;}
}


